💵Swiss NGOs estimate CHF 100m shortfall from foreign donors. Humanitarian and development actors are still struggling to understand the extent of the cuts by the United States and other international donors, and estimate the number of lives affected. A survey by a Swiss NGO platform sheds some light on these figures.

✈️UN Geneva told to weigh job moves amid deepening funding crisis. The United Nations Office at Geneva has been instructed to consider relocating jobs to lower-cost countries as part of a major cost-cutting drive from UN headquarters in New York. The revelation comes as UN staff unions, dismayed by a flurry of layoff announcements, prepare to demonstrate on 1 May.

🇧🇮Funding crisis threatens refugee work in Burundi, hitting women, Children, says UN. Over 71,000 people fleeing the violence in eastern Democratic Republic of Congo have arrived in the country this year.

🚷US backs Israel's ban on UNRWA Gaza aid operations at World Court. Israel had passed a law last year barring the Palestinian aid agency from operating within its territory and hindering its work in those it occupies.
